I have some Excel files into Prism. When I try to open the Prism file, I see an "error" message from Excel.

This may occur with Prism 3 for Windows. When you try to open the Prism file, a message from Excel asks:
"The workbook you opened contains automatic links to information in another workbook. Do you want to update this workbook with changes made to the other workbook? Press "Yes" to update all linked info or "No" to keep existing information"
That message is coming from Excel, and it probably has nothing to do with Prism. To prove this, open the file from Excel with Prism closed. You'll probably see the same message. To find out why, drop the Edit menu and choose "Links" (from Excel, with the file open). You'll see a list of links into that Excel file, and you can delete links that were inadvertent. Prism does not link well to Excel files that themselves are linked to other files.
